Program
Depending on the school size, the Digital Exchange Program can have between 15-45 Japanese students. Elementary school classes are usually 45 minutes, and Junior High school classes are 50 minutes, but for the exchange, the duration would be around 15 minutes. These exchanges can be repeated a few times a semester as well. There are usually three semesters in a Japanese school. Also, Japanese schools usually have Spring (March/April), Summer (July/August), and Winter (December/January) vacations, so it may be possible to do the exchange during these dates.
